They made it a point in an earlier scene to show that Walter moved the pen on Heidi's desk at Homecoming at an angle.

I think the interpretation here is: the fact that he couldn't leave the fork alone and also placed it at an angle indicated to her that the Walter she knew was still in there somewhere, and there was hope for rekindling their relationship. I think that one little thing gave her the push she needed to stick around.
